Educational assessment is a process used in schools to determine a student's knowledge, understanding, and skills in measurable terms (Popham, 2006). Where assessment was once only used to see if a student had learned a given objective at the end of a unit or course, today educational assessment is used to measure the substance of schools, teacher, and students. Many schools now require students to pass state tests or other forms of assessment in order to graduate. Colleges also require certain scores on the Scholastic Aptitude Test (SAT) or American College Test (ACT) to be accepted into their school. Another form of assessment that has grown in the past decade is the World- Class Instructional Design and Assessment (WIDA). Two forms of assessment widely used in the Pascagoula School District are the ACT and the WIDA. With so much importance placed on student's results from these two tests, the purpose, role, and reliability should be looked at thoroughly.
